⚡️ Silver Hits $100: A Historic Breakout & What It Means 💰🌍
🚀 The Rally
- Silver has surged past $100 per ounce, a level never seen before.
- Driven by structural supply deficits, industrial demand, and monetary stress.
- Gold’s rise near $5,000 has compressed the gold-to-silver ratio to 50, boosting silver’s relative appeal.
- Supply Crunch: Global mine output flat at ~813M oz, while deficits topped 820M oz over 5 years.
- Industrial Demand: Silver is essential for solar, EVs, and electronics, fueling long-term growth.
- Geopolitical Stress: Export controls and monetary uncertainty have accelerated safe-haven buying.
📊 Investor Implications
- Opportunities: Hedge against inflation, strong industrial upside, relative value vs. gold.
- Risks: High volatility, limited supply response, potential policy shifts.
